Rosebery population growth

How the population of Rosebery, NSW (2018) changed across ABS Census years from 2011 to 2021.

Population

Census 2011 → 2016 → 2021

+59.6% over 10 years

20118,479201610,117202113,533
2011 and 2016 figures are mapped onto 2021 suburb boundaries, so comparisons are approximate where borders changed.

2011 population

8,479

2016 population

10,117

2021 population

13,533

2011 → 2021

+59.6%

+3,416 since 2016

Change since the previous Census. Historical figures are mapped from State Suburbs (SSC) to today's suburb boundaries.
